FAQs

How are baptisms done at The Table Church?

At The Table we baptize in all ways: sprinkling, pouring, and immersion. Typically, we baptize adults and kids by immersion.

Who should consider being baptized?
     
  • Anyone who has made a commitment to Christ who has not yet been baptized.
  •  
  • Those who want to renew their commitment to Christ.
  •  
  • Parents who want to baptize their child and dedicate raising their child to follow Christ.
What if I’ve already been baptized?

While we don’t “rebaptize” we will do a reaffirmation of baptism for those who desire it. You can be dunked, too.
